Transaction 58f5928103b37e2f70b4118a45f7479a9052c60d662fc5647503bccf3670ce5a

1 Input
2 Outputs
  • 58f5928103b37e2f70b4118a45f7479a9052c60d662fc5647503bccf3670ce5a:0
  • value  1003723
    address  2Mv58Nex3GCFxeyNQ3VNZY5e8zKy3skoytC
  • 58f5928103b37e2f70b4118a45f7479a9052c60d662fc5647503bccf3670ce5a:1
  • value  7969198551
    address  2MssE6wnPyJdHpNnLAdfMMUJybaTqbE1NxZ